Transaction 8b577fcde1b2a31514bb8c837deb560cf9d4b46d0016de8e29f91043ddf35696
1 Input
2 Outputs
- 8b577fcde1b2a31514bb8c837deb560cf9d4b46d0016de8e29f91043ddf35696:0
- 8b577fcde1b2a31514bb8c837deb560cf9d4b46d0016de8e29f91043ddf35696:1
value 599215
address 3HaMg4SbeqZAYyDzrTwHqg9Fy3JcewbLug
value 607011
address 134Ac3GMuTagr65CQGvsAPsJRrAndefzm5